Cotto won't hurt Clottey with body shots
Very nice but what people tend to forget boxers with the Ghanian guard are rarely hurt by body shots. Oscar De La Hoya really attacked Felix Sturms body and Shane Mosley went after Winky Wrights. Both had little effect (i know people are gonna mention they were to small but there are the best examples i know). When was Azumah Nelson or Ike Quartey ever hurt by a body shot? As a guys hands arepurely protecting his face he is mentally prepared for body shots. Plus its not like Margo didn't hit Clottey with body shots with the 1500 punches he threw.
On the other hand Cotto will find it harder to tag Clotteys face than he did Margarito's so he will invest in the body surely. I just don't see it being effective especially when Clottey is gonna weigh 165 pounds plus. This is his chance to step into the spotlight and he is gonna take out years of frustration on Cotto and stop him late. He is gonna have to have a better workrate than he did against Judah.

I expect he will have enough to take it anyway, however, Cotto seems a fighter who really requires that mental edge & if he starts getting hurt by Clottey's uppercuts, then he might start doubting whether Margarito really had plaster in his gloves, & this could lose him the fight. Clottey isn't the hardest puncher, but he can break people down.
Michael Jennings, Cotto's last victim, was on a boxing show yesterday, & whilst he picked Cotto to win, when asked if he was the hardest puncher he'd faced he said no. He said, whilst he hadn't been hit by as accurate a puncher, he had been hit harder with harder individual punches than those Cotto got him with. Just thought that was interesting considering how we go on about what a power-puncher Cotto is
